I give iPad classes at a computer club, and I've run into a weird problem. Siri has activated on a few students iPads during the classes. Is it possible to shut Siri off and then later turn it back on without affecting the way it operates for that user? I'm guessing Siri must be picking up my voice and trying to figure out what I'm saying.

This is very strange.....they weren't holding in their home buttons without realising? It's an easy thing to do.

You can turn Siri off....go to Settings - General - Siri.....there's a link there which does provide some info on what happens when Siri is turned off.

You will also get this message if you do go to turn it off...
